0

我有enum_cars

我有列表userown_cars: enum_cars[]

例如,当我获取用户模型和获取own_cars字段时,我有:

user.own_cars #=> "{Ford}" String

我连接了

DB.extension :pg_array

Sequel.extension :pg_array

但这对我不起作用。我应该怎么做才能获取字段Array?或者枚举数组是不可能的?

4

1 回答 1

1

解决这个问题。

如果您在表数组枚举字段中有您应该注册数组类型:

DB.extension :pg_array
DB.register_array_type(:enum_cars)
于 2017-10-03T08:34:39.190 回答